Climate overview of Nouart

The climate in Nouart, Champagne - Ardenne, France, is marked by large temperature swings across the seasons, ranging from 25°C (77°F) in July to 6°C (43°F) in January.

With around 989 mm (39 in) of annual rain/snowfall, the city has moderate precipitation levels. December is the wettest month and April the driest. It also has warm summers and cold winters.

Monthly Temperature in Nouart

In Nouart, temperatures differ significantly between summer and winter months. Typically, average maximum daytime temperatures range from a comfortable 25°C (77°F) in July to a chilly 6°C (43°F) in the coolest month, January.

Nights vary from 14°C (57°F) in July to around 0°C (32°F) during the colder months.

Rainfall in Nouart

On average, Nouart receives a reasonable amount of rain/snowfall, with an annual precipitation of 989 mm (39 in). Nouart offers a pleasant mix of wetter and slightly drier months. The difference in precipitation between the wettest month December (113 mm (4.4 in)) and the driest month April (68 mm (2.7 in)) is not too significant. Best Time to Visit Nouart

For comfortable weather, consider visiting Nouart in June, July, August and September. Conditions are usually least favourable in January, February, November and December.

Monthly ratings reflect general weather comfort, based on daytime temperature and rainfall. Swimming and winter conditions are highlighted separately where relevant.

  • Best overall: June, July, August and September
  • Warmest weather: July and August
  • Seasonal pattern: Warm summers and cold winters
